WebMar 28, 2024 · biotechnology, the use of biology to solve problems and make useful products. The most prominent area of biotechnology is the production of therapeutic proteins and other drugs through genetic engineering . Biotechnology has numerous applications, particularly in medicine and agriculture. … dfa online appointment for minor

Associate Professor, PhD Position in Systems Biology, Commercieel Manager en meer op Indeed.com WebNanobiotechnology is often used to describe the overlapping multidisciplinary activities associated with biosensors, particularly where photonics, chemistry, biology, biophysics, nanomedicine, and engineering converge. Measurement in biology using wave guide techniques, such as dual-polarization interferometry, is another example.
